UL Scientists Achieve World-First Dual-Cation Battery Breakthrough

Researchers at University of Limerick have created the world’s first full-cell dual-cation battery system. The breakthrough combines lithium and sodium ions to significantly improve battery capacity and stability while reducing environmental impact.

In a world-first breakthrough that could transform energy storage technology, scientists at the University of Limerick have developed a revolutionary dual-cation battery system that combines the strengths of both sodium and lithium ions. This innovative approach addresses fundamental limitations in current battery technology while creating a more sustainable and higher-performing energy storage solution for electric vehicles and portable electronics.

Vulcan Energy Signs Major Lithium Supply Deal with Glencore for European Project

Vulcan Energy has secured a significant lithium hydroxide supply agreement with mining giant Glencore for its Lionheart Project in Europe. The eight-year deal represents approximately 20% of Vulcan’s planned Phase One output and marks the final offtake agreement for project financing. This partnership strengthens Europe’s position in the global electric vehicle supply chain.

Australian lithium developer Vulcan Energy has signed a strategic supply agreement with global mining giant Glencore to provide lithium hydroxide monohydrate from its European operations, marking a significant advancement in the continent’s electric vehicle battery supply chain. The eight-year deal represents approximately 20% of Vulcan’s planned Phase One production capacity and solidifies the company’s position as a key player in Europe’s green energy transition.
